Jak rozpocząć programowanie dla nowej strony internetowejCzy chciałeś stworzyć nową stronę internetową, ale nie wiesz od czego zacząć? Programowanie może wydawać się onieśmielającym zadaniem, ale może być o wiele prostsze, jeśli masz odpowiednie wskazówki. W tym przewodniku krok po kroku dowiesz się, jak rozpocząć programowanie dla nowej strony internetowej. Od zrozumienia podstaw języków kodowania do skonfigurowania środowiska programistycznego, będziesz miał narzędzia do stworzenia własnej strony internetowej od podstaw. Poznasz najlepsze praktyki kodowania i otrzymasz wskazówki, jak unikać typowych błędów, aby pomóc w sukcesie projektu internetowego.

Podstawy tworzenia stron internetowych

Tworzenie stron internetowych to proces tworzenia stron internetowych przy użyciu kodu napisanego w językach programowania, takich jak HTML, CSS i JavaScript. Kod dla tych stron jest przechowywany na tzw. serwerach. Kiedy ktoś odwiedza Twoją stronę, jego przeglądarka (Google Chrome, Safari, itp.) żąda kodu z serwera i wyświetla go na ekranie. Kod jest odpowiedzialny za wszystko, od układu strony po treść, która się na niej znajduje.

Tworzenie stron internetowych to bardzo szeroki temat. Może obejmować wszystko, począwszy od konfiguracji środowiska programistycznego, a skończywszy na projektowaniu witryny. Jednakże, na potrzeby tego przewodnika, skupimy się na stronie kodowania.

a. Rodzaje języków kodowania

Istnieje wiele różnych języków kodowania, których możesz użyć do stworzenia strony internetowej. Niektóre z najbardziej popularnych to HTML, CSS i JavaScript. - HTML to skrót od HyperText Markup Language, czyli języka znaczników hipertekstowych. Ten kod jest odpowiedzialny za układ strony, jak np. rozmieszczenie poszczególnych elementów na stronie i sposób ich stylizacji.

- CSS to skrót od Cascading Style Sheets. Ten kod jest odpowiedzialny za wygląd Twojej strony, taki jak kolor i czcionki użyte w układzie.

- JavaScript jest rodzajem kodu, który jest używany dla funkcjonalności na Twojej stronie, takich jak dodanie wyskakującego okienka, gdy ktoś kliknie na przycisk.

Każdy z tych typów kodu ma swoje własne najlepsze praktyki, które omówimy bardziej szczegółowo w dalszej części tego artykułu. Na razie najważniejszą rzeczą do zrozumienia jest to, że istnieje wiele różnych rodzajów kodu, które możesz wykorzystać do stworzenia strony internetowej.

b. Środowiska programistyczne

Kiedy tworzysz nową stronę internetową, istnieją dwie główne części: front-end i back-end. Front-end jest odpowiedzialny za wygląd strony i doświadczenie użytkownika, podczas gdy back-end jest odpowiedzialny za przechowywanie danych i kontrolowanie front-endu. Kiedy zaczniesz programować, będziesz musiał stworzyć obie te części. Aby to zrobić, będziesz potrzebował środowiska programistycznego, w którym będziesz pisał kod zarówno dla front-endu, jak i back-endu. Istnieje wiele różnych narzędzi, których możesz do tego użyć. Do najpopularniejszych należą:

- Edytor tekstu - Edytor tekstu to oprogramowanie, które pozwala na pisanie kodu. Jest to bardzo prosty i powszechny sposób pisania kodu, a wielu programistów pisze swój kod w prostym edytorze tekstu, takim jak Notatnik.

- Zintegrowane środowisko programistyczne (IDE) - IDE jest bardziej zaawansowaną wersją edytora tekstu. Pozwala na pisanie kodu, a także testowanie go, aby upewnić się, że działa poprawnie. Niektóre popularne IDE to Visual Studio i PyCharm.

- Platforma jako usługa (PAAS) - W przypadku PAAS, piszesz kod na swoim komputerze, a on wysyła go na serwer, gdzie kod jest wykonywany. Ten typ środowiska programistycznego ułatwia współpracę z innymi osobami, które również piszą kod dla projektu.

- Zdalny serwer - Jeśli chcesz hostować swoją stronę online, będziesz musiał użyć zdalnego serwera. Oznacza to, że Twój kod jest umieszczony na zdalnym serwerze, a ludzie mają do niego dostęp przez internet. Jeśli używasz zdalnego serwera do pisania kodu, będziesz musiał przenieść go na swój komputer, zanim będziesz mógł go przetestować.

Najlepsze praktyki kodowania

Jak już omówiliśmy, istnieje wiele różnych typów kodu, których możesz użyć do stworzenia strony internetowej. Przy tak wielu różnych opcjach może być trudno wiedzieć, od czego zacząć. Może być również trudno wiedzieć, czy twój kod jest napisany poprawnie. Aby ułatwić ten proces, istnieje kilka najlepszych praktyk, które można śledzić. Pomogą Ci one stworzyć najlepszy możliwy kod i ułatwią innym programistom pracę z Twoim kodem.

- Zachowaj prostotę - Nie musisz tworzyć kodu, który jest nadmiernie skomplikowany. Możesz napisać bardzo prosty kod, który robi wszystko, czego potrzebujesz.

- Oddziel różne komponenty - Jeśli tworzysz stronę, która ma blog i platformę eCommerce, ważne jest, aby oddzielić te komponenty. Pomaga to uczynić Twój kod bardziej wydajnym i łatwiejszym do pracy dla innych osób.

- Używaj najlepszych praktyk specyficznych dla danego języka - Jeśli piszesz kod w języku takim jak PHP, będziesz chciał się upewnić, że używasz kodu zgodnie z najlepszymi praktykami tego języka. Pomogą Ci one stworzyć bardziej wydajny kod.

- Komentuj swój kod - Kiedy piszesz kod, ważne jest, aby go komentować, aby inni programiści mogli zobaczyć, co on robi. Może to pomóc uniknąć zamieszania i ułatwić wszystkim współpracę nad projektem.

Porady dotyczące unikania najczęstszych błędów

Gdy zaczynasz pisać kod dla swojej strony internetowej, może być łatwo popełnić typowe błędy. Aby pomóc Ci ich uniknąć, wymieniliśmy kilka wskazówek, o których powinieneś pamiętać:

- Bądź na bieżąco z najnowszymi osiągnięciami - Kiedy programujesz, musisz wiedzieć, co robią inni programiści i jakie nowości się pojawiają. Pomoże to upewnić się, że twój kod jest kompatybilny z innymi programistami i nową technologią.

- Koduj z zespołem - Niezwykle ważne jest, aby kodować z zespołem. Pomoże to zapobiec błędom i upewnić się, że kod wszystkich jest ze sobą kompatybilny.

- Testuj swój kod - Możesz przetestować swój kod na kilka różnych sposobów. Możesz przetestować go ręcznie poprzez przeglądarkę, aby upewnić się, że działa poprawnie. Możesz również napisać kod, aby przetestować inne części swojego kodu, aby upewnić się, że działa on poprawnie.

- Planuj na przyszłość - Kiedy tworzysz nową stronę internetową, ważne jest, aby myśleć o przyszłości. Będziesz chciał, aby Twój kod był jak najbardziej elastyczny, aby mógł dostosować się do nowych technologii i zmieniających się trendów.

Konfiguracja środowiska programistycznego

Teraz, gdy poznałeś już podstawy tworzenia stron internetowych, czas zabrać się za rozwijanie swojej witryny. W tym celu będziesz musiał skonfigurować swoje środowisko programistyczne. Dzięki temu będziesz mógł pisać kod na swoim komputerze i wysyłać go na zdalny serwer, gdzie będzie mógł być wykonany. Aby mieć największe szanse na sukces, zalecamy, abyś do pisania kodu używał edytora tekstu.

Pozwoli Ci to na szybkie i łatwe pisanie kodu, bez potrzeby korzystania z bardziej złożonego środowiska programistycznego. Niektóre popularne edytory tekstu to Sublime Text i Notepad. Następnie musisz skonfigurować zdalny serwer, na którym będziesz pisał i hostował swój kod. Istnieje wiele różnych serwerów zdalnych, których możesz użyć, takich jak Amazon Web Services (AWS) i Google Cloud Platform. Kiedy już skonfigurujesz swój zdalny serwer i napiszesz swój kod, będziesz musiał przenieść go na swój komputer, abyś mógł go przetestować.